ST. JAMES THEATRE
The latest ol the popular Dr Gillespie series, ” Dark Delusion,” starring Lionel Barrymore, with James Craig and Lucille Bremer, will be shown to-morrow at the St. James Theatre. As the gruff but lovable Dr Leonard Gillespie, Lionel Barrymore delivers his usual polished performance. James Craig makes his first appearance in the series as the blunt, aggressive Dr Tommy Coalt whose highhanded tactics almost bring about his dismissal from the hospital. Another newcomer to the series is beautiful Lucille Bremer, who is seen as a lovely young heiress believed insane by her family physician. Her case is defended by the impulsive Dr Coalt, who refuses to believe that she is unbalanced. The suspenseful plot is enlivened by many exciting incidents and a generous quantity ol humour.
